100% de satisfacción garantizada Inmediatamente disponible después del pago Tanto en línea como en PDF No estas atado a nada 4,6 TrustPilot
logo-home
Notas de lectura

Structured query language SQL

Puntuación
-
Vendido
-
Páginas
79
Subido en
13-01-2022
Escrito en
2020/2021

Lecture notes of 79 pages for the course Computer Science at CAM (Basics of SQL)

Institución
Grado











Ups! No podemos cargar tu documento ahora. Inténtalo de nuevo o contacta con soporte.

Escuela, estudio y materia

Institución
Estudio
Grado

Información del documento

Subido en
13 de enero de 2022
Número de páginas
79
Escrito en
2020/2021
Tipo
Notas de lectura
Profesor(es)
Bjjh
Contiene
Todas las clases

Temas

Vista previa del contenido

https://www.halvorsen.blog




Structured Query Language
Hans-Petter Halvorsen




Available Online: https://www.halvorsen.blog

,Structured Query Language

Hans-Petter Halvorsen
Copyright © 2017




https://www.halvorsen.blog

,Table of Contents
1 Introduction to SQL ........................................................................................................... 6

1.1 Data Definition Language (DDL).................................................................................. 8

1.2 Data Manipulation Language (DML) ........................................................................... 8

2 Introduction to SQL Server ................................................................................................ 9

2.1 SQL Server Management Studio ............................................................................... 10

2.1.1 Create a new Database...................................................................................... 11

2.1.2 Queries .............................................................................................................. 12

3 CREATE TABLE ................................................................................................................. 13

3.1 Database Modelling .................................................................................................. 15

3.2 Create Tables using the Designer Tools .................................................................... 17

3.3 SQL Constraints ......................................................................................................... 17

3.3.1 PRIMARY KEY ..................................................................................................... 18

3.3.2 FOREIGN KEY ..................................................................................................... 19

3.3.3 NOT NULL / Required Columns ......................................................................... 22

3.3.4 UNIQUE ............................................................................................................. 23

3.3.5 CHECK ................................................................................................................ 25

3.3.6 DEFAULT ............................................................................................................ 27

3.3.7 AUTO INCREMENT or IDENTITY ......................................................................... 28

3.4 ALTER TABLE ............................................................................................................. 29

4 INSERT INTO .................................................................................................................... 31

5 UPDATE ........................................................................................................................... 33

3

, 4 Table of Contents

6 DELETE ............................................................................................................................. 35

7 SELECT ............................................................................................................................. 37

7.1 The ORDER BY Keyword ............................................................................................ 39

7.2 SELECT DISTINCT ....................................................................................................... 40

7.3 The WHERE Clause .................................................................................................... 40

7.3.1 Operators .......................................................................................................... 41

7.3.2 LIKE Operator .................................................................................................... 41

7.3.3 IN Operator........................................................................................................ 42

7.3.4 BETWEEN Operator ........................................................................................... 42

7.4 Wildcards .................................................................................................................. 42

7.5 AND & OR Operators ................................................................................................ 43

7.6 SELECT TOP Clause .................................................................................................... 44

7.7 Alias .......................................................................................................................... 45

7.8 Joins .......................................................................................................................... 45

7.8.1 Different SQL JOINs ........................................................................................... 46

8 SQL Scripts ....................................................................................................................... 48

8.1 Using Comments ....................................................................................................... 48

8.1.1 Single-line comment .......................................................................................... 48

8.1.2 Multiple-line comment ...................................................................................... 48

8.2 Variables ................................................................................................................... 49

8.3 Built-in Global Variables ........................................................................................... 50

8.3.1 @@IDENTITY ..................................................................................................... 50

8.4 Flow Control ............................................................................................................. 51

8.4.1 IF – ELSE ............................................................................................................. 51

8.4.2 WHILE ................................................................................................................ 52

8.4.3 CASE................................................................................................................... 53

Structured Query Language (SQL)
$14.20
Accede al documento completo:

100% de satisfacción garantizada
Inmediatamente disponible después del pago
Tanto en línea como en PDF
No estas atado a nada

Conoce al vendedor
Seller avatar
abdalkareemadel93

Documento también disponible en un lote

Conoce al vendedor

Seller avatar
abdalkareemadel93
Seguir Necesitas iniciar sesión para seguir a otros usuarios o asignaturas
Vendido
0
Miembro desde
4 año
Número de seguidores
0
Documentos
7
Última venta
-

0.0

0 reseñas

5
0
4
0
3
0
2
0
1
0

Recientemente visto por ti

Por qué los estudiantes eligen Stuvia

Creado por compañeros estudiantes, verificado por reseñas

Calidad en la que puedes confiar: escrito por estudiantes que aprobaron y evaluado por otros que han usado estos resúmenes.

¿No estás satisfecho? Elige otro documento

¡No te preocupes! Puedes elegir directamente otro documento que se ajuste mejor a lo que buscas.

Paga como quieras, empieza a estudiar al instante

Sin suscripción, sin compromisos. Paga como estés acostumbrado con tarjeta de crédito y descarga tu documento PDF inmediatamente.

Student with book image

“Comprado, descargado y aprobado. Así de fácil puede ser.”

Alisha Student

Preguntas frecuentes